As Bid Coordinator, you'll play a pivotal role in helping the business secure new opportunities by:

Identifying exciting tender and framework opportunities through a range of online portals

Coordinating the end-to-end bid process, ensuring submissions are delivered on time and to the highest standard

Supporting bid qualification and go/no-go decisions

Researching opportunities and gathering information to create compelling proposal responses

Formatting, proofreading and producing professional, high-quality bid documentation

Collaborating with subject matter experts to develop engaging proposal content

Managing project schedules, deadlines and bid trackers

Maintaining bid libraries and ensuring documentation is organised and up to date

Analysing bid activity and supporting continuous improvement of bidding processes

Working across multiple teams to help deliver successful projects and commercial growth

About You

You'll be someone who enjoys organising complex pieces of work, thrives on meeting deadlines and takes pride in producing accurate, polished documentation.

You'll ideally have:

Previous experience in bid coordination, proposal support, project administration or a similar role

Excellent written communication and proofreading skills

Strong organisational and planning abilities

The confidence to manage multiple priorities simultaneously

A proactive, positive approach and excellent attention to detail

Strong Microsoft Office skills including Word, Excel, Outlook, Teams and SharePoint

The ability to build effective working relationships across different teams

It would be great if you also had but not essential

Experience with bid or tender portals

Knowledge of project planning tools such as (url removed) or AccessPlanIt

Experience within learning & development, professional services or consultancy

PRINCE2, APM PFQ or bid management qualifications
